Man arrested for armed robberies in Grande Prairie and Dawson Creek

A man believed to be responsible for armed robberies in both Dawson Creek and Grande Prairie is back in police custody. The George Dawson Inn was robbed on August 26th by a man described as in his fifties, 6 feet tall, wearing a blue hoodie with a distinctive emblem on it. He was armed with a knife.

A man wearing the same clothes had robbed a man at the South 40 RBC in GP two days earlier. The 47 year old man was arrested on September 14th in Dawson Creek.

He was released after a court hearing, but has since been picked up on an extended warrent by Grande Prairie RCMP. He has been re-arrested and is waiting to appear in Grande Prairie court on more armed robbery charges.
